Output f74039fadb9742aef9eb46487edc3b8fde5ec1e5c84d5fbcc6cd3b3d188e8541:6

value
1648349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3defaf5934bb1dcee98767fc1f8a67d99f539c OP_EQUAL
address
3HaKhL5KEshxMdUFcrPfy2ziJjpukemfpL
transaction
f74039fadb9742aef9eb46487edc3b8fde5ec1e5c84d5fbcc6cd3b3d188e8541
confirmations
427083
spent
true